When You Were Young
Originally released in 1967. When You Were Young is a drama film. directed by Buichi Saitō.
Starring Sayuri Yoshinaga, Masakane Yonekura, and Yukiyo Toake
Synopsis
Kaori is a new director at a TV station and is assigned to work on her first documentary project, “Kimi ga Seishun no Toki” (When You Were Young), a documentary on modern youth and the Harajuku tribe. However, she gets too involved and ends up hurting her documentary subjects.
